t(11;14)(q13;q32)(CCND1,IGH) fusion transcript [Presence] in Bone marrow by Molecular genetics method

Definition

PCR-based assays are used to detect and monitor CCND1-IGH t(11;14)(q13;q32) gene translocations in patients with lymphoproliferations. This test is based on, but not limited to the IdentiClone BCL1/JH Translocation Assay, which targets the MTC region of the CCND1/IGH gene fusion and amplifies genomic DNA between primers that target the CCND1 (also known as BCL1) gene and the conserved joining (JH) regions of the IGH gene.

What is LOINC?

LOINC (Logical Observation Identifiers Names and Codes) is a universal standard for identifying laboratory and clinical observations. It is maintained by the Regenstrief Institute and used worldwide for health data exchange.
